On Wed, 2017-05-17 at 10:41 +0100, Bin.Cheng wrote: > I happen to be working on loop distribution now (If guess correctly, > to get hmmer fixed). So far my idea is to fuse the finest > distributed > loop in two passes, in the first pass, we merge all SCCs due to > "true" > data dependence; in the second one we identify all SCCs and breaks > them on dependent edges due to possible alias. Breaking SCCs with > minimal edge set can be modeled as Feedback arc set problem which is > NP-hard. Fortunately the problem is small in our case and there are > approximation algorithms. OTOH, we should also improve loop > distribution/fusion to maximize parallelism / minimize > synchronization, as well as maximize data locality, but I think this > is not needed to get hmmer vectorized.
